The Evolution of Cornbread
I often write about my Southern roots. I grew up in rural Sussex County, Virginia. I am one of ten siblings raised by our mother. All the siblings had chores to do on designated days. I enjoyed cooking on days when we had certain foods to eat. I loved it when my day included cornbread instead of biscuits. Cooking cornbread was much easier and required less time than making biscuits from scratch. Besides, there were only two ingredients to make cornbread.

1. Stir-Fried Oyster Mushrooms Blanch oyster mushrooms for one minute, then drain thoroughly. Scramble eggs separately until fluffy. Sauté garlic and chili until fragrant, add bell peppers and carrots. Combine all ingredients with light soy sauce, oyster sauce, salt, and chicken powder. The mushrooms provide umami depth while maintaining a meat-free profile.
